<b>Press Release</b>
Free Ninja Gaiden 2 Magazine

GamerZines.com produces one-off magazine dedicated to Xbox 360 exclusive game as free download

GamerZines.com, the portal for free digital magazines for gamers, today announced the immediate availability of the Ninja Gaiden 2 magazine. Produced by the same team that create the free monthly Xbox 360 magazine, 360Zine, the Ninja Gaiden 2 magazine offers a complete guide to the upcoming Xbox 360 title.

“Getting access to Ninja Gaiden 2 to produce this magazine meant that we could produce a unique guide that lifts the lid on the game that many Xbox 360 gamers can’t wait to play. Everyone wants to know how the sequel can improve on the Ninja Gaiden series, but all the signs are that NG2 is going to deliver in spades” says Editorial Director, Dan Hutchinson.

The magazine gives readers a quick history of Ninja Gaiden before diving into the in-depth tour of the new game, complete with hi-resolution screens, interactive elements and gameplay video all available directly on the magazine pages.

The issue also includes an exclusive competition to win an Xbox 360 signed by legendary producer Tomonobu Itagaki as well as details on how readers can keep up to date with Ninja Gaiden 2 details on the web and on their mobile phone.

All GamerZines.com magazines are professionally written and produced by a team of games journalists and publishers with decades of experience in the magazine industry. The portal offers free monthly magazines for various games platforms in interactive PDF format. All the magazines are enhanced with rich media and extensive video of the games in action.

Readers do not need to register to download the magazines, which are all completely free. All that is required to view the magazines is Adobe Reader version 6 or above on Windows or Mac, and a broadband internet connection.
